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48209957 4168763 147 30506
505788 308254 650624821
505788 308254 650624821
71892 61698 26491838 370847
All about undefined
Interested in learning more?
505788 308254 650624821
71892 61698 26491838 370847
See more
50261334659 41104067727
626713224 579 93938
See more
08 39297491161 7003193189
77 0196 034346 4137526 6016477
See more